Description
Fly beyond the ordinary and into the extraordinary this Christmas with Neverland at Kenwood. Begin your adventure in a reimagined London, passing glowing landmarks and twinkling skylines before soaring into the magic of Neverland. Wander through the Lost Boys’ hideout, brave the mysterious Skull Rock, and come face-to-face with Captain Hook’s iconic ship — all beautifully illuminated in this immersive outdoor trail.
